Introduction
The apparel export market presents numerous opportunities but also challenges for suppliers. Understanding these hurdles and devising effective strategies is essential for success.
Complex Regulations and Compliance
Each market has its own set of regulations and compliance standards, which can be overwhelming for suppliers. Staying informed and ensuring compliance with international laws is critical.
Strategies for Compliance
Engaging with export consultants and legal experts can help suppliers navigate these complexities and avoid costly penalties.
Logistical Challenges
Logistics play a vital role in the export process. Delays in shipping and transportation can affect delivery times, ultimately impacting customer satisfaction.
Optimizing Logistics
Establishing strong relationships with logistics providers and utilizing technology for tracking can enhance operational efficiency.
Market Competition
The apparel market is highly competitive, making it challenging for suppliers to stand out. Understanding market trends and differentiating products is crucial.
Branding and Marketing
Investing in branding and marketing strategies can help suppliers create a unique identity, attracting more clients.
Conclusion
Successfully navigating the challenges of apparel exports requires strategic planning and execution. By addressing regulatory complexities, optimizing logistics, and enhancing branding, suppliers can thrive in the global market.
